The Opportunity

QBE is seeking a Senior Technical Underwriter to join our growing London Trade Finance Solutions (TFS) team.

This is a unique and senior role supporting the continued growth of the TFS portfolio, with a particular focus on the legal and technical aspects of underwriting, including underlying trade and Non-trade finance facility documentation, policy wordings, and transaction structuring.

We are looking for an individual with a legal background and strong interest in underwriting and insurance, who can bring technical and legal expertise while remaining actively involved in underwriting decisions. The role offers a balanced split between technical/legal responsibilities and underwriting activity and will evolve over time based on the individual’s strengths and interests.

This is an exciting opportunity for a legal or underwriting professional looking to further their career in insurance, gain broad exposure to a wide range of short and long‑term debt and trade finance products, and play a key role in supporting the strategic growth of the business.

Your new role

This role supports business strategy through technical expertise, underwriting judgement, and legal oversight, helping ensure that transactions are appropriately structured, documented, and underwritten in line with QBE’s risk appetite.

Key responsibilities include supporting underwriting activity, owning and developing the legal and technical framework underpinning the TFS portfolio, and acting as a trusted subject‑matter expert to the wider team.

  • Support the development and delivery of the annual business plan for the Trade Finance Solutions portfolio.
  • Underwrite Non‑Payment Insurance and trade finance credit risks in line with agreed risk appetite and underwriting authority.
  • Take ownership of the legal and technical review of transactions, including underlying trade finance facilities, security structures, and policy wordings.
  • Provide guidance on legal, regulatory, and documentation matters relevant to trade finance and credit insurance, including emerging market practices and trends.
  • Support the structuring of complex or non‑standard transactions, working closely with underwriters, brokers, banks, and internal stakeholders.
  • Maintain oversight of relevant legal and regulatory developments (e.g. licensing, compliance, market standards) and assess their impact on the portfolio.
  • Contribute to portfolio review and analysis, identifying trends, concentrations, and opportunities to enhance underwriting quality and profitability.
  • Act as a technical point of reference within the team, supporting peer review and underwriting excellence.
  • Continually develop expertise across both underwriting and technical disciplines in a fast‑paced and evolving environment.
About you
  • A qualified lawyer with meaningful PQE, or equivalent experience within insurance, trade finance, or structured credit environments.
  • Strong interest in underwriting and insurance, with the ability to combine legal judgement with commercial and credit risk considerations.
  • Experience of, or exposure to, trade finance, structured lending, or corporate financing facilities provided by banks to corporate clients.
  • Some familiarity with Basel regulations and Loan Market Association (LMA) documentation would be advantageous.
